Please join our organization Global Shout on October 4th, 2024, at DACOR Bacon House in Washington, D.C. from 5:30pm to 8:30pm as we gather together three years after the events surrounding the U.S. withdrawal from Afghanistan and the evacuation of Afghan military and civilians turned refugees. We will be remembering the events of that period and reflecting on the past three years of efforts by our organization and others to welcome our allies to the United States and give them an opportunity at peace and a better life. We will hear from the refugees themselves throughout the night and we will be partnering with DACOR, an organization of foreign affairs professionals, members of the State Department, and officials from USAID, who will also speak regarding the current state of affairs in Afghanistan, and in the United States regarding the plight of the refugees.
     This is a fundraiser event meant to support Global Shout in providing continued assistance to the over 8000 refugees we have helped so far over the past three years in home furnishing and move-ins, clothing and food assistance, health care provisioning, English as a second language classes, social services, job training and acquisition, and asylum and legal aide. Afghan hors d’oeuvres will be provided from the renowned DC based Afghan restaurant Lapis, along with a silent auction of Afghan goods, and a viewing of the documentary film trailer produced and directed by Global Shout’s founder Dr. Ali Karim. Global Shout is a U.S. based 501(c)3 tax-exempt (EIN#: 85-2382286) non-profit organization originally founded by students at Georgetown University in 2005 as Global S.H.O.U.T. (Students Helping Orphans in Underprivileged Territories). After an early focus strictly on the education and care of orphaned children in third world nations, the organization underwent a gradual shift in scope of humanitarian work, expanding beyond the university and dropping the acronym, with a full rebranding in 2019-20, now operating projects internationally of varying type and purpose.
